Overall the property is quite nice, however, I would not have it as a five star hotel. The area of Seminyak is not the best place to be in Bali and the hotel is a good bit away from where you want to be and all of the roads have no footpaths and is pretty crazy to walk along.
Pros:
- Villa is lovely with big outdoor space and private pool.
- Staff are nice but lack common awareness for guest experience.
Cons:
- Found mouse droppings all over the Villa.
- Area is awkward to walk anywhere to and requires taxi (they offer a shuttle within seninyak but are largely too busy to drop you or can only take you 5 mins down the road).
- Food was not great in the restaurant and very much dead.
- Went to watch the music in the restaurant on the Sunday (supposed to be playing from 6 - 9) but the musician was gone for a 45 min break (during a 3 hour set) and didn’t get to see him.
- Spa is way overpriced in comparison to local spas.
- Only had breakfast once during 3 night stay as they don’t serve before 7. They charge 180k for the floating tray. I was hoping to get this waived as I only breakfast once but they were unwilling to do so.
